Precentages are simple. No, really.
I think percentages are simple. Take 100%, for example: it means everything. And 0% means nothing. 50% is about half.
Per cent of course means “per hundred”, so 27% is just a short way of saying “27 per hundred”, or 27/100, or 0.27. Really, is that hard?
